### Mitigation plan: Glintframe image cache leak

Profiling on the Harrowmede staging cluster confirmed that decoded bitmaps are retained by the preview carousel long after eviction, because the cache keys include a rotating session token. The fix canonicalizes keys and adds a hard byte ceiling with periodic sweeps. For the release manager: the sweep cadence and ceiling are release-gated and must ship together. The agreed constants for the first rollout are listed here.

constants for bawif-kawif:
QUOTAS = {
    "ulaael": 5,
    "holael": 10,
}

## Step 4: Dual-write phase

With the expand migration applied, enable dual-writes so Ledgerline writes to both the old and new columns. Reviewers should confirm the feature flag defaults to off in production until backfill completes, and that reads still come from the legacy column. Verify the migration worker's batch size won't saturate the replica. The settings controlling this phase are shown below.

deployment values, fahap-hahaf:
[casdor]
port = 9200
region = south-2
host = casdor.qirvanworks.corp
timeout_ms = 3000
retries = 4

Roof-terrace door — known issue

Reception staff: the terrace door on level 6 of Ashgrove Point jams in damp weather. Do not force it — lift the handle, then push. If it sticks fully, log it with Facilities; do not prop it open. Smokers will ask you to unlock it constantly; the terrace opens at 08:00 regardless. The pass code for the terrace door is below.

door code, yagap-bahof: bdg-O-05